Cooking method
- Wash and dry the tomatoes. Cut the tomatoes and cheese into rounds. Wash and dry the basil leaves and chop them coarsely. Arrange the tomatoes and cheese on a platter in a circle, alternating them, and garnish with the chopped basil. Mix the olive oil with the balsamic vinegar and dress the salad with the mixture.
